Arsenal fans should return for Sheffield United despite West Ham disappointment
Arsenal are making to plans to accommodate fans back to the Emirates on October 3 for their second home game of the season against Sheffield United. Initial hopes that supporters would have been in attendance for the London derby with West Ham appear to have been dashed. Coronavirus protocols will be in place and the crowd will be 30 per cent of the full Emirates capacity of 60,000. A ballet system will decide which 18,000 of the club's 45,000 season ticket holders will be able to watch the match.
